In Grover, Missouri, a community of over 8,000 residents, access to mental health support is crucial. Virtual Intensive Outpatient Programs (IOP) provide an essential service for individuals dealing with mental health and substance use disorders. With the convenience of online therapy, residents can receive structured treatment while remaining engaged with their families and jobs.

The benefits of Virtual IOP are numerous for Grover locals. You can attend sessions from the comfort of your home, eliminating the need for a commute and allowing you to maintain your work, school, or family commitments. Programs typically involve 9-20 hours of therapy each week, featuring evidence-based treatments like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T). This flexible approach ensures you receive the support you need, tailored to your unique circumstances.

Getting started with a Virtual IOP is simple. Most programs accept major insurances, including Medicare and Medicaid, making it easier to find affordable care. Sessions may include individual and group therapy, as well as family involvement, all led by licensed professionals. Embark Behavioral Health Virtual IOP

Mental Health & Substance UseVerified
Available in 17 States
Preteens, adolescents, teens, and young adults (generally ages 12-34)
(443) 390-5670

Intensive group and individual therapy tailored to youth; utilizes evidence-based modalities like CBT, DBT, and Exposure Response Prevention specifically for this age group. Family involvement is emphasized to support teens/young adults. Offers an OCD-specific virtual track through partnership with IOCDF. Operates in a wide range of states with virtual care to increase access.
